Applying for grants

The Lenoir County Community Foundation (LCCF) Unrestricted Endowment will accept grant applications from March 17, 2023, to NOON on April 18, 2023. Funds are available for qualified charitable organizations serving the local community.

Grants typically range from $500 to $3,000.

About LCCF’s grantmaking

Founded in 1993, the Lenior County Community Foundation is led by a local volunteer advisory board. Each year, LCCF uses dollars from its endowment funds to make grants to nonprofits that help the local community.

Grants will be awarded from the:

  • Lenoir County Community Foundation Unrestricted Endowment.
  • Warren and Barbara Perry Fund.
  • Oakland Fund, which supports education and youth.

In 2022 LCCF awarded more than $13,000 in grants. Learn more about past grant recipients.
